The wheels I'm getting are 18x8...
My previous set up was 225/40R18 and I'm thinking of going to a 235/40R18 for a wider tire... From the research I've done, it doesn't look like im going to have any problems... Tires will be Falken Azenis RT-615's on an 18x8 wheel... anybody else running this set up or anyone have any information that could help me out? Will this tire set-up work... Wheel: 18x8... Tire: 235/40R18 Falken Azenis RT-615 All information is appreciated... These tire's will also be used for auto-x'ing Your truly, SBX Falken Azenis RT-615: ![]()
